- 博客(15)
- 资源 (4)
- 问答 (1)
- 收藏
- 关注
原创 内核打补丁
内核打补丁 如果需要的某些特性并没有被现有内核支持,则需要去获取相关的补丁。比如,为了使内核支持图形化的启动界面,我们可能要用到bootsplash工具。!bootsplash项目 http://www.bootsplash.org/ 上提供了针对很多内核版本的补丁供下载。 通过打补丁升级内核 通过打补丁的方法升级内核,可以不用下载整个内核源码。针对每个内核版本的补丁文件可以在 ftp.ker...
2018-10-10 15:37:31
3446
1
原创 安装内核
安装内核 使用发行版提供的安装脚本 几乎所有的发行版都提供了installkernel脚本,这样就不需要开发者做任何额外的工作,内核编译系统就可以通过它把内核自动安装到正确的位置并修改bootloader。 如果你已经构建好了一些模块并想使用这种方法安装内核,首先输入: # make modules_install 以上命令将安装所有构建好的模块,并将其置于文件系统中新内核能够找到的合适位置...
2018-10-09 22:54:58
2213
原创 配置和编译内核
配置和编译内核 配置内核的基本方法是使用make config: $ cd linux-2.6.28 $ make config 此配置选项将逐步跟踪每一个配置选项,并询问你是否要启用该选项。通常情况下,选项以**[Y/m/n/?]**的形式列出,其中大写字母是默认配置项,只需按下Enter键即可选中。四个选项的含义如下: y 直接构建为内核的一部分 n 完全不构建到内核中 m ...
2018-10-09 15:58:28
887
原创 ubuntu14.04 搭建Qt5开发环境
ubuntu14.04 搭建Qt5开发环境 在ubuntu14.04中使用命令行搭建Qt5开发环境,非常的简单。命令走起: sudo apt-get install qt5*(不清楚具体包名是哈,干脆全部安装了) sudo apt-get install qt5-default qttools5-dev-tools(安装Qt assistant和Qt designer) 安装完成之后,可直接在命...
2018-10-01 11:37:53
2887
原创 ubuntu14.04中使用命令行安装ARM平台交叉编译工具
走起,直接上命令: sudo apt-get install gcc-arm-linux-gnueabihf
2018-09-28 22:33:13
1331
原创 Ubuntu14.04中更换软件包的更新原服务器地址
Ubuntu14.04中更换软件包的更新原服务器地址 使用Ubuntu14.04时,默认安装和更新软件包的话都是从us.archive.ubuntu.com这个美国的服务器上进行安装和更新的,但是在天朝的网络环境下连接这个服务器时更新会很慢,有时可能还会更新失败,因此考虑将服务器地址替换成国内大公司的做的镜像服务器: 方式: 打开文件 sudo vim /etc/apt/sources....
2018-03-08 16:48:57
1439
原创 OpenStack多节点安装(六):Horizon
上篇文章讲述了如何安装网络服务组件(Neutron)后,本文开始讲述如何安装仪表盘服务组件(Horizon)。 1. 安装并配置组件 sudo apt install openstack-dashboard 编辑配置文件/etc/openstack-dashboard/local_settings.py, 并完成如下字段的修改: OPENSTACK_HOST = "192.16
2017-07-10 00:46:06
848
原创 OpenStack多节点安装(五):Neutron
上篇文章讲述了如何安装计算服务组件(Nova),本文开始讲述如何安装网络服务组件(Neutron)。 在安装和配置Neutron服务之前,必须先完成数据库,服务凭证以及API endpoints的创建 1.创建数据库 mysql -u root -p CREATE DATABASE neutron; GRANT ALL PRIVILEGES ON neutron.* TO
2017-07-10 00:44:02
1084
原创 OpenStack多节点安装(四):Compute
上篇文章讲述了如何安装镜像服务(Glance),本文将继续讲解如何搭建Openstack计算服务组件(Compute)。废话不多说,直接开始。(就是干!) 在安装和配置Compute服务之前,必须先完成数据库,服务凭证以及API endpoints的创建 1.创建数据库 mysql -u root -p CREATE DATABASE nova_api; CREATE DATABS
2017-07-08 12:59:36
1483
原创 OpenStack多节点安装(三):Glance
上篇文章讲述了如何安装Identity service(Keystone),本文将继续讲解如何安装Glance(镜像服务)。 1. 首先先配置两个客户端脚本文件:admin-openrc and demo-openrc,方便后面执行openstack客户端命令程序 admin_openrc文件内容: export OS_PROJECT_DOMAIN_NAME=Default ex
2017-07-08 11:24:16
1246
原创 OpenStack多节点安装(二):Keystone
上篇文章讲了关于OpenStack多节点基础环境的搭建,本文开始讲述如何搭建Keystone服务。 1. 登录mysql服务器中,创建数据库keystone,并授予适当的访问权限: sudo mysql -u root -p create database keystone; grant all privileges on keystone.* to 'keystone'@'l
2017-07-08 11:16:32
1567
原创 OpenStack多节点安装(一):基本环境
之前一直都是使用的DevStack开发环境在调试代码,今天开始尝试着部署OpenStack多节点(我自己的是两个节点:controller和compute)环境,参照官方文档:OpenStack官方文档 系统环境:VMware + Ubuntu16.04-server
2017-07-08 11:06:09
6194
原创 如何重启DevStack所有服务
关闭虚拟机之后,安装好的DevStack参考快速搭建OpenStack开发环境的所有服务也随之关闭了,如果使用./stack.sh重新运行的话需要等待一段比较长的时间,因此考虑使用(没有rejoin-stack.sh脚本的情况下): screen -c stack-screenrc执行命令后,出现如下界面: 最下面的状态行,表示开启的所有服务,比如当前看到的服务是horizon(服
2017-06-26 00:31:52
7060
2
原创 解决Compressing... /home/stack/devstack/lib/horizon: line 99: 22567 Killed错误
今天作死似的又在Ubuntu14.04-desktop版本中尝试着安装了一下DevStack(之前也写过一篇关于快速搭建DevStack的文章,请参考快速搭建OpenStack开发环境),然后就悲剧的遇到了下面这个问题: 不过最后还是顺利的解决了这个问题:通过增加虚拟机的物理内存,刚开始分配的内存是2G,最后把它增加到4G,然后再重新运行./stack.sh,等待一段时间后,成功啦(截图
2017-06-25 12:50:53
1381
USB3.0 控制器报错
2021-05-13
TA创建的收藏夹 TA关注的收藏夹
TA关注的人
RSS订阅